New Breed of Personal Capital Companies Will Face Efficiency Headwinds
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


Below the personal fairness fundraising mannequin, each few years fund managers safe capital commitments with a 10-year length and cost administration and advisory charges through the lock-up interval. Whereas longer-dated merchandise have emerged over time, the essential sample has remained primarily unchanged.

Sadly, fundraising is cyclical. Downturns require endurance: Fund managers should wait till the inexperienced shoots of restoration seem earlier than going again to marketplace for a brand new classic.

Clearing the Fundraising Hurdle

Financial slowdowns have an effect on the credit score provide, capital availability, and the well being of portfolio belongings. Within the wake of the worldwide monetary disaster (GFC), even massive corporations like UK-based Terra Firma couldn’t shut a recent classic, whereas others — BC Companions, for instance — barely survived, sustaining their asset bases however by no means really increasing once more.

World operators, too, struggled to get again on the expansion path. Some, comparable to TPG and Windfall Fairness, had problem attracting recent commitments and raised far lower than they’d for his or her pre-GFC autos. KKR took eight years to shut a brand new flagship buyout fund, gathering $9 billion in 2014, barely half the $17.6 billion it had generated for its earlier classic.

Whereas small fund managers have been caught with the legacy mannequin, the most important gamers seemed elsewhere for options. Vertical integration was one path ahead: For instance, Carlyle acquired fund of funds supervisor Alpinvest from pension funds APG and PGGM in 2011.

Warren Buffett’s Berkshire Hathaway provided PE corporations a brand new template. Because of the float of its automobile insurance coverage unit, GEICO, the corporate has everlasting entry to a perennial pool of capital. Apollo, Blackstone, and KKR, amongst others, all acquired insurance coverage companies over the previous decade to reap an identical fount of capital and leverage a perpetual supply of charges.

Indecent Publicity

However there’s a snag. Insurance coverage is delicate to random variables: Rampant inflation, for instance, results in increased claims prices and decrease earnings, particularly for property-liability insurers. Sudden rate of interest actions or, within the case of life insurers, unexpectedly excessive mortality charges (e.g., because of a pandemic) can have outsized results on the underside line.

The Monetary Stability Board (FSB) in the USA suspended the worldwide systemically essential insurer (GSII) designation two years in the past, acknowledging that the insurance coverage trade, not like its banking counterpart, doesn’t current a systemic threat. However the macroeconomic backdrop is way tougher to regulate than company issues and might hinder money flows.

As such, the failure of a person insurer won’t have a domino impact, nevertheless it could possibly be precipitated by a extreme lack of liquidity. That consequence is extra seemingly when the insurer is uncovered to illiquid personal markets. So, a sustained financial disaster might impede a PE-owned insurer’s potential to underwrite insurance policies, challenge annuities, or settle claims.

Insurers have a public mission to cowl the well being or property of their varied policyholders. PE corporations, however, have a major fiduciary responsibility to institutional traders. Certainly, not like personal capital, the insurance coverage trade is extremely regulated with strict authorized obligations. This has important implications. For instance, previous customer support and company governance points at life insurers Athene and World Atlantic, right now owned respectively by Apollo and KKR, resulted in heavy fines. Such incidents can expose personal capital to public scrutiny and make the commerce extra unpredictable, particularly when insurance coverage actions account for a lot of the enterprise. Final yr, as an illustration, Athene represented 30% of Apollo’s income.

Alternate options Supermarkets

One other resolution to the PE fundraising dilemma was asset diversification, a blueprint first carried out by industrial banks within the late Nineteen Nineties and early 2000s.

Citi and the Royal Financial institution of Scotland (RBS) acquired or established capital market models and insurance coverage actions to provide purchasers a one-stop store. Cross-selling has the twin benefit of constructing every account extra worthwhile and growing buyer stickiness.

Blackstone, Apollo, Carlyle, and KKR (BACK) constructed comparable platforms to assist yield-seeking LP traders diversify throughout the choice asset class. They now provide single-digit-yielding merchandise like credit score alongside riskier higher-return leverage buyout options in addition to longer-dated however low-yielding infrastructure and actual asset investments.

By elevating funds for separate and unbiased asset courses, BACK corporations protect themselves from a possible capital market shutdown. Whereas debt markets suffered through the GFC, for instance, infrastructure confirmed outstanding resilience.

Nonetheless, such improvements have drawbacks. “Common” banks underperformed their smaller and extra tightly managed rivals. Opportunistic deal-doing betrayed an absence of focus. As an example, RBS acquired used-car dealership Dixon Motors in 2002 regardless of little proof of potential synergies. As well as, a pathological obsession with return on fairness (ROE) did not account for the declining high quality of the underlying belongings. Furthermore, retail bankers often proved to be mediocre merchants, M&A brokers, company lenders, and insurers.

Early indications counsel that multi-product platforms like BACK might not be capable to produce the most effective outcomes throughout the complete spectrum of personal markets. Carlyle’s mortgage-bond fund operations and its actions in Central Europe, Jap Europe, and Africa in addition to KKR’s European buyout unit all failed or struggled previously, which demonstrates monitoring and sustaining efficiency throughout the board whereas operating a monetary conglomerate. Murky product-bundling might additional hamper returns at these world-straddling various asset supermarkets.

A Efficiency Conundrum

That diversification decreases threat whereas reducing anticipated returns is certainly one of financial concept’s bedrock rules. But, in 2008, diversification at “common” banks confirmed how threat will be mispriced when the efficiency correlation between merchandise is underestimated. Threat can enhance when all-out progress methods aren’t accompanied by ample checks and balances. The quasi-exclusive emphasis on capital accumulation and fee-related earnings by publicly listed various fund managers might come on the expense of future returns.

That is one lesson of Berkshire Hathaway’s enterprise mannequin that the brand new breed of PE corporations might not acknowledge. Reaching unconditional entry to a capital pool is one factor; placing that capital to work is sort of one other. The money surplus from the insurance coverage float — over $100 billion as of 30 June –has made it just about inconceivable for Berkshire Hathaway to beat public benchmarks, particularly when damaging actual rates of interest encourage competitors by means of unrestrained credit score creation and asset inflation.

PE corporations amassing funds to increase past their core competency will face comparable headwinds. Perpetual capital has develop into the alt specialist’s most important division. Blackstone’s grew 110% year-over-year (YoY) within the quarter ending 30 June to achieve $356 billion, or 38% of its whole asset pool, whereas Apollo’s $299 billion perpetual capital base climbed to 58% of belongings beneath administration (AUM). Blackstone sat on $170 billion of undrawn capital on the finish of June, whereas Apollo had $50 billion to play with. That’s lots of dry powder to place to work, which might solely drag returns down.

A everlasting and diversified capital base might soothe PE’s fundraising starvation pangs, however the related insurance coverage actions and multi-asset methods might trigger a full-on case of funding efficiency indigestion.
